How to Turn Body Spray Into Solid Perfume

Steps

Gather your ingredients.

Place all ingredients except for body spray/perfume in a glass bowl, dish, jar, or cup. Create a double boiler or if you already have one, use it! (You can leave out the glass dish if you are using a real double boiler) Create one by heating a saucepan of water and placing your glass container in the water until wax and petroleum jelly have melted. After they have melted give it a stir and add your perfume/body spray of choice.

Give it a little time to boil up and do it's thing! As the mixture bubbles, the alcohol is being boiled off so the end result will be a bit stronger than it was in the bottle, and it will last longer on skin. The longer you boil it, the stronger it will be.

After 3-5 minutes of boiling (depending on how strong you'd like it) pour your mixture into a clean container. If you want to take it on the go, get a container with a lid or use an old lip balm tube for easy application on the go!

After you've poured it, place in the fridge or freezer for a few hours to set. You can leave it out on the counter if you'd like. Of course, leaving it at room temperature will take longer. After it's set, leave it for a few hours to rest.

To apply, rub your finger around in the container, then dab it on the areas you would like to scent. If using a lip balm tube, rub directly on the skin. Good places to apply are the pulse points: sides of the neck, behind the ears, back of the knees, wrists, cleavage, and the elbow crease on your arm.

Perfume Oil

Gather your ingredients. You will need carrier oil and perfume/body spray for this one.

Place ingredients in double boiler, or a makeshift double boiler.

Boil for 3-5 minutes, depending on how strong you would like your scent to be.

After it's boiled up, take it off the heat and pour into a clean bottle or other container.

Let sit for a few hours until it has cooled down.

To apply, rub a small amount anywhere you would like. Arms, legs, chest, back, you name it! Except for your face. Don't do that.
